Location, Location, Location: Indoor vs. Outdoor
The most critical factor in selecting an advertising screen is its intended location. Indoor and outdoor environments present vastly different challenges. Outdoor screens must contend with direct sunlight, rain, dust, temperature extremes, and potential vandalism. For these applications, you need a screen with high brightness—typically measured in nits—often exceeding 5,000 to 10,000 nits to be visible during the day. In Hong Kong, where neon signs and digital displays are a staple of the cityscape, outdoor LED screens must also adhere to strict light pollution regulations while remaining effective in high-humidity conditions. Conversely, indoor screens, used in malls, conference centers, or retail stores, require lower brightness levels (around 500 to 2,000 nits) to avoid eye strain. They also offer a finer pixel pitch, allowing for higher resolution at closer viewing distances. When evaluating advertising screens for sale, always ask for an IP rating; an outdoor screen should have at least IP65 certification to protect against water and dust ingress. Ignoring this distinction can lead to premature failure, where a screen designed for indoor use fades or stops functioning when exposed to the elements.
Screen Size and Resolution: Finding the Perfect Fit
Size and resolution are intrinsically linked. A common mistake is choosing a screen that is too large for the viewing distance, resulting in a pixelated image. The ideal screen size depends on the average distance from the audience to the display. For example, a screen viewed from 10 feet away requires a much finer pixel pitch (e.g., P2 or P3) compared to a billboard viewed from 100 feet away (where P10 or P16 suffices). In Hong Kong, where space is at a premium, many businesses opt for custom-sized LED panels that can be tiled to fit specific architectural dimensions. Resolution is also dictated by the content you plan to display. If you are showing detailed text or high-definition video, a 4K resolution is preferable. However, for simple logos or text scrolls, a lower resolution LED screen can still be effective and more cost-efficient. When browsing through listings of led billboard for sale, pay attention to the module size and pixel configuration. A higher density of LEDs per square meter yields a sharper image but also increases the cost. Balancing these factors against your budget and content requirements is the key to a successful purchase.
Brightness and Visibility: Ensuring Clear Display
Brightness is non-negotiable, especially for outdoor advertising. Measured in nits (candelas per square meter), this specification determines how legible your screen will be under ambient light. In bright Hong Kong sunlight, a screen with less than 5,000 nits will likely appear washed out. However, brightness should be adjustable via an automatic light sensor. A screen that is too bright at night can cause glare and annoy residents, potentially leading to complaints or fines. Many modern led screens for sale come with adaptive brightness control, which automatically dims the display during low-light conditions. Additionally, the viewing angle is crucial. If your screen is placed on a busy street corner, choose a model with a wide viewing angle (160 degrees or more) to ensure visibility from different approaches. Contrast ratio is another factor; a high contrast ratio (e.g., 5000:1) helps blacks appear deeper, making colors pop more vividly. For indoor environments, anti-glare coatings can also improve visibility, reducing reflections from overhead lighting.
Durability and Weather Resistance (Outdoor Screens)
For outdoor installations, durability is paramount. In a subtropical climate like that of Hong Kong, screens are exposed to typhoon-force winds, heavy rain, and high humidity. The casing of an outdoor LED screen should be made from corrosion-resistant materials such as die-cast aluminum. Look for screens with an IP65 (Ingress Protection) rating or higher, which guarantees protection against dust and low-pressure water jets from any direction. Additionally, the screen should have a built-in cooling system—either fans or heat sinks—to prevent overheating in direct sun. Some manufacturers offer screens with UV-resistant coatings to prevent yellowing over time. When considering an advertising screens for sale for outdoor use, inquire about the warranty and the manufacturer's track record in similar climates. A cheap screen might save money upfront but could fail within a year due to water ingress or corrosion, leading to costly repairs or replacements.
Power Consumption and Energy Efficiency
Running a large advertising screen 24/7 can lead to substantial electricity bills. Energy efficiency is therefore a critical consideration, especially for businesses in Hong Kong where utility costs are high. LED technology is generally more energy-efficient than older technologies like plasma, but there are still differences between models. Look for screens with high energy efficiency ratings, often indicated by the lumens per watt output. Some modern led billboard for sale models feature energy-saving modes that reduce power consumption during low-traffic hours or when the ambient light is low. Additionally, using a smart power management system that turns off the screen during unoccupied periods (e.g., after midnight) can result in significant savings. When calculating the total cost of ownership, factor in the local electricity tariff (approximately HKD 1.2 to 1.5 per kWh in Hong Kong) and estimate the annual running cost. A screen that is 10% more efficient might save thousands of dollars over its lifespan.

LED Screens: Bright and Versatile
LED (Light Emitting Diode) screens are the gold standard for outdoor advertising. They consist of thousands of tiny LEDs arranged in a matrix, offering exceptional brightness, color accuracy, and longevity. These screens can be seamlessly tiled to create massive video walls of any size or shape. They are ideal for high-traffic areas like Causeway Bay or Tsim Sha Tsui in Hong Kong, where visibility from a distance is essential. One of the key benefits of LED screens is their modularity; if a single diode fails, it can be replaced individually without changing the entire panel. When searching for led screens for sale, you will encounter terms like 'SMD' (Surface-Mount Device) and 'COB' (Chip-on-Board). SMD screens are common and offer good color consistency, while COB technology provides better protection against moisture and physical damage, making it superior for harsh environments. LED screens also have a fast refresh rate, ensuring smooth video playback without flickering, which is critical for capturing the attention of moving audiences.
LCD Screens: Cost-Effective and High-Resolution
Liquid Crystal Display (LCD) screens, often used in digital signage, are a cost-effective alternative for indoor applications. They offer excellent resolution and color reproduction, especially at close viewing distances. Commonly found in shopping malls, hotel lobbies, and corporate offices, LCD screens are available in standard sizes (e.g., 55-inch, 65-inch, 86-inch) and can be used in video walls when bezels are minimized. They are less expensive per unit area compared to LED screens for indoor use. However, they are not suitable for outdoor environments because their brightness is limited and they can suffer from heat damage. For businesses looking for an affordable entry point into digital advertising, a set of commercial-grade LCD screens can be a smart investment. When evaluating advertising screens for sale in the LCD category, pay attention to the panel type (IPS is preferred for wide viewing angles) and the brightness rating (at least 500 nits for bright indoor spaces).
Projection Screens: Large-Format and Immersive
Projection systems offer a unique way to create large-scale immersive experiences. They are often used for temporary events, art installations, or indoor settings where a massive display is needed without the weight of a traditional screen. Laser projectors, in particular, offer high brightness and long lifespans, making them viable for semi-permanent installations. In Hong Kong, projection mapping on building facades has become a popular form of advertising, especially during festivals. However, projection screens require controlled lighting conditions; ambient light can wash out the image. They are not typically a direct competitor to led billboard for sale for permanent outdoor use, but they excel in scenarios requiring a temporary or highly creative visual impact.
Transparent Screens: Innovative and Eye-Catching
Transparent OLED and LED screens represent the cutting edge of advertising technology. These screens allow light to pass through them, enabling retailers to display digital content on glass windows without blocking the view inside. This creates a 'window display' effect that is both modern and functional. In Hong Kong's luxury retail sector, transparent screens are increasingly popular for storefronts along Queen's Road Central. They draw attention without obscuring the merchandise behind the glass. While still relatively expensive, the novelty and visual appeal of transparent led screens for sale can justify the investment for high-end brands looking to differentiate themselves.
Cost and Budget Considerations
Initial Purchase Price vs. Long-Term ROI
The upfront cost of an advertising screen can range from a few thousand dollars for a small indoor LCD to hundreds of thousands for a large outdoor LED wall. However, focusing solely on the purchase price is a mistake. Consider the long-term Return on Investment (ROI). A cheaper screen might have lower resolution, higher power consumption, or a shorter lifespan, ultimately costing more over time. For example, a premium led billboard for sale might last 100,000 hours (over 11 years of continuous use), while a budget model might fail after 50,000 hours. Calculate the cost per hour of operation to get a true comparison.
| Factor | Low-Cost Screen | Premium Screen |
|---|---|---|
| Initial Price (per sqm) | HKD 15,000 | HKD 35,000 |
| Lifespan (hours) | 50,000 | 100,000 |
| Power Consumption (W/sqm) | 300 | 200 |
| Cost per Hour (depreciation + power) | ~HKD 0.50 | ~HKD 0.42 |
As shown, the premium screen can be cheaper in the long run due to lower power consumption and longer lifespan.
Maintenance and Repair Costs
All electronic displays will require maintenance. For LED screens, this includes cleaning the modules, checking power supplies, and occasionally replacing damaged LED pixels. In Hong Kong, where air pollution can cause dust buildup, regular cleaning is essential. When purchasing advertising screens for sale, ask about the availability of spare parts and the cost of on-site service contracts. Some manufacturers offer warranties that cover parts and labor for 3-5 years, which can provide peace of mind. Budget at least 5-10% of the initial cost per year for maintenance.
Software and Content Management Fees
An often-overlooked cost is the software needed to manage the content on your screen. Most professional screens require a Content Management System (CMS) to schedule and upload videos. Some CMS platforms are cloud-based with monthly fees, while others are one-time purchases. Additionally, you may need to pay for content creation services. If you cannot design your own ads, hiring a graphic designer or video editor will add to the budget. When comparing led screens for sale, check if the price includes a basic CMS license.

Installation and Maintenance Tips
Professional Installation vs. DIY
Given the weight, complexity, and electrical requirements of large advertising screens, professional installation is strongly recommended. A certified installer can ensure that the screen is properly anchored to the building structure, that all power and data cables are correctly routed, and that the screen is calibrated for optimal performance. In Hong Kong, installation often requires a Minor Works Contractor license for structural modifications. While a DIY approach might seem cost-saving for small indoor screens, mistakes can lead to accidents or voided warranties. For any advertising screens for sale that require permanent mounting, budget for professional installation costs.
Regular Cleaning and Maintenance
To maintain brightness and image quality, regular cleaning is necessary. Outdoor screens should be cleaned monthly with a soft brush or low-pressure water spray (for IP65-rated screens) to remove dust and bird droppings. Indoor screens can be cleaned with a microfiber cloth. Avoid using harsh chemicals that can damage the screen coating. Also, inspect the screen's ventilation system to ensure it is free from blockages, as overheating can shorten the lifespan of the LEDs.
Troubleshooting Common Issues
Common issues include dead pixels, flickering, or power failures. A single dead pixel is usually not a major concern and can be replaced during routine maintenance. Flickering often indicates a loose cable or a failing power supply. Most modern led billboard for sale systems come with diagnostic software that can identify faulty modules. Keep a log of any issues and contact your supplier's technical support. Having a few spare modules on hand can minimize downtime.
